ailanthus : Idioms & Phrases


ailanthus altissima

  • noun deciduous rapidly growing tree of China with foliage like sumac and sweetish fetid flowers; widely planted in United States as a street tree because of its resistance to pollution
    tree of the gods; tree of heaven.
WordNet

ailanthus silkworm

  • noun large green silkworm of the cynthia moth
    Samia cynthia.
WordNet

genus ailanthus

  • noun small genus of east Asian and Chinese trees with odd-pinnate leaves and long twisted samaras
WordNet